Understanding Vietnam’s Crypto Landscape
Vietnam has emerged as a hotspot for cryptocurrency, attracting numerous investors and enthusiasts. Recent reports indicate that the number of Vietnamese crypto users increased by 210% from 2020 to 2023. This surge is fueled by technological adoption and a youthful demographic eager for innovative investment opportunities.
- Young Population: Over 70% of Vietnam’s population is under 35.
- Tech Adoption Rates: Vietnam ranks among the highest in Southeast Asia for mobile internet usage, making crypto easily accessible.
- Emerging Entrepreneurs: Many startups in Vietnam are leveraging blockchain technology to address local issues.
